We began this protocol 3 months before we started trying. Dr. Clark and her husband began their protocol 6 months before they started trying. The guidance generally says anywhere from 3-6 months.

This was my prenatal for both pregnancies. Mel’s guidance on prenatals calls it one of the two bare minimum staples during pregnancy (alongside fish oil). What matters is that it’s methylated, meaning the B vitamins are in their active, bioavailable forms. This is especially important for women with MTHFR mutations who can’t efficiently convert folic acid. I was initially taking extra methylated folate, but Dr. Mel took me off it because the Designs for Health Prenatal Pro already had a sufficient amount. In the OB community, standard of care is still folic acid, but Mel noted that high amounts of folic acid in those who don’t methylate can have negative outcomes. Royal jelly can act on the hypothalamic-pituitary-gonadal axis, which is the communication pathway between your brain and your ovaries. It can intensify that signaling so everything communicates better. An animal study showed that royal jelly significantly increased the development of ovarian follicles and raised estrogen and progesterone levels. In subjects with premature ovarian failure, royal jelly actually helped restore ovarian function so they could conceive. It improved hormonal and oxidative markers in a rat model, which could be beneficial for women with PCOS.

This is to boosts NAD+ levels. NAD+ is critical for mitochondrial function, and it declines in the ovaries as we age, which is one of the reasons egg quality drops over time. Researchers recently identified that an enzyme called CD38 degrades NAD+ in the ovaries, accelerating the loss of egg quality and quantity. In animal studies, NR supplementation increased ovarian reserve, improved oocyte quality, and elevated live birth rates. It also rebalanced mitochondrial dynamics in aging ovaries by correcting folliculogenesis abnormalities.

This hasn’t been tested in humans for fertility yet, but the mechanism suggests it could help.

Most people think of melatonin as a sleep supplement, but Dr. Mel explains that it’s actually a powerful antioxidant that can be helpful for both sperm production and ovaries. Women with unexplained infertility were found to have blunted intrafollicular melatonin concentrations with marked oxidative imbalance. Most of the research on fertility benefits is done at 1 to 3 milligrams, which is lower than what a lot of people take for sleep.

Dr. Mel suggests personalizing the dose. Some people feel groggy even at 1mg, and if that’s you, it’s not worth pushing through. I tolerated 1mg well and took it nightly.

Specifically myo-inositol and D-chiro-inositol. Dr. Mel calls this one of the most studied supplements for PCOS. A clinical study found that the 40:1 ratio of myo-inositol to D-chiro-inositol was most effective at restoring ovulation in PCOS women. A meta-analysis of 17 studies showed it significantly increased clinical pregnancy rate and top-grade embryos. One important thing to note is that the ratio of myo to D-chiro matters. Increasing D-chiro alone can actually worsen outcomes. Look for products like Vitamica powder or Pure Encapsulations Inositol Complex that get this right.

Even if you don’t have PCOS, inositol supports ovarian follicle health and insulin sensitivity, which are foundational to fertility.

CoQ10 provides mitochondrial support and antioxidant protection. Eggs are among the most mitochondria-dense cells in the body, and CoQ10 supports the energy production those mitochondria need while also reducing reactive oxygen species.

A randomized controlled trial in women with diminished ovarian reserve found that CoQ10 pretreatment increased retrieved oocytes, produced a higher fertilization rate, and resulted in more high-quality embryos. Significantly fewer women in the CoQ10 group had cancelled transfers due to poor embryo development (8.33% vs 22.89%).

The ubiquinol form (the reduced, active form of CoQ10) is better absorbed than standard CoQ10.

Mel didn’t do a deep dive on vitamin D in the podcast, but it was part of my daily stack and she includes it as a foundational nutrient. The research shows that women undergoing IVF with vitamin D levels below 20 ng/mL had clinical pregnancy rates of just 20% compared to 31% in women with sufficient levels. A meta-analysis found that live birth was more likely in women with adequate vitamin D. A comprehensive review confirmed that vitamin D deficiency is a risk marker for reduced fertility and adverse pregnancy outcomes, and that supplementation decreases both maternal and fetal complications. Most of us are D deficient. Get your levels tested and supplement accordingly.

If you want to keep the male stack simple, Mel’s simplified recommendation would be royal jelly, a men’s multi, and omega-3. The DHA found in fish oil is structurally critical for sperm. It helps with motility and egg penetration. A cross-sectional study of nearly 1,700 men found that men who took fish oil supplements had higher semen volume, higher total sperm count, larger testes, and a more favorable reproductive hormone profile (lower FSH, lower LH, higher free testosterone-to-LH ratio) compared to non-supplementers. A double-blind RCT in 238 infertile men found that 1.84g/day of EPA+DHA for 32 weeks nearly doubled sperm concentration and significantly increased total sperm count.

The research on ashwagandha (KSM-66 specifically) for male fertility is promising. A pilot study in oligospermic men showed a 167% increase in sperm count, 53% increase in semen volume, and 57% increase in sperm motility after 90 days of ashwagandha supplementation. A systematic review confirmed notable increases in total and free testosterone, and a 2026 double-blind RCT confirmed improvements in sexual health and reproductive hormones.

The mechanism of action here is the cortisol connection. Chronic stress elevates cortisol, which directly suppresses testosterone and impairs sperm production. Ashwagandha acts on the HPA axis to reduce cortisol, which breaks that cycle. For men who are stressed, this is doing double duty for both quality of life and sperm quality.

A men’s multivitamin is super important from a micronutrient standpoint, and the key nutrient Dr. Mel highlighted was zinc. Zinc is a must for men because it’s essential for sperm production, testosterone production, and testosterone receptor sensitivity (how well testosterone talks to the cell). A landmark study found that young men on a zinc-restricted diet saw their testosterone drop roughly 73%, while zinc-deficient older men who supplemented nearly doubled theirs.

An emerging area of research is how the gut microbiome affects male fertility. A recent research review found that the bacteria in your gut influence testosterone levels, sperm production, and oxidative stress, which is estimated to be a factor in up to 80% of unexplained male infertility cases. In one trial, infertile men with poor motility who took a probiotic saw “drastically improved” sperm motility and reduced DNA fragmentation after just 6 weeks. Another RCT found that probiotic and prebiotic supplementation improved sperm count, concentration, and progressive motility and five participants in the study achieved paternity.

Mel didn’t discuss creatine on the podcast, but I added it to my stack for this pregnancy based on emerging research. Creatine supports cellular energy production through a different pathway than CoQ10 or NAD+ in that it replenishes ATP directly in high-demand tissues. During pregnancy, creatine demand increases significantly because it’s needed for fetal brain, organ, and tissue development. A review in Nutrients found that maternal creatine supplementation in animal models improved fetal outcomes including brain development and survival under birth stress. Human studies are still limited, but creatine is increasingly recognized as conditionally essential during pregnancy because maternal synthesis can’t keep up with the demands of a growing fetus.

Dr. Mel’s calcium discussions on the podcast focused on postpartum, but she noted that “next pregnancy I’ll probably add calcium to my supplement list” even during pregnancy. The reasoning is that baby draws about 300mg of calcium per day from you, and if you’re not getting enough exogenously, it comes from your bones. Mel recommends 1000-1300mg daily during breastfeeding, but starting during pregnancy gives you a head start on protecting your bone density for the demands that come after delivery.

Pregnancy can disrupt digestion because pregnancy hormones (especially high progesterone) can slow gut motility and cause constipation that many women have never experienced before. I didn’t have a ton of bloating or constipation during my first pregnancy, and I credit this supplement. Most probiotics don’t include butyrate, but this one does. Mel calls butyrate “so amazing… so healing for the intestinal lining.” During breastfeeding, probiotics also transfer to baby through breast milk.

Mel also recommended magnesium supplementation during pregnancy for constipation management, so I’ve been taking that as well. Beyond constipation, magnesium is essential for over 300 enzymatic reactions and supports mitochondrial function. During pregnancy, magnesium requirements increase and deficiency is associated with preeclampsia, preterm labor, and fetal growth restriction.
